In the United States, 11 graduate schools are offering Anesthesiologist Assistant programs. The average graduate tuition & fees for Anesthesiologist Assistant programs is $10,958 for state residents and $27,659 for out-of-state students


Career after Completing Anesthesiologist Assistant Program

After completing a Anesthesiologist Assistant major, you may further your career by choosing one of the following occupations. The average annual wage of Physician Assistants career is $119,460 and, for Medical Assistants, the average annual income is $38,190.

The average wage is based on the latest employment and wage data (May 2023) from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S).
